2025年底的 TailwindCSS 组件库简单横评 - 程序设计实验室

2025年底的 TailwindCSS 组件库简单横评 - 程序设计实验室

💡 原文中文,约2500字,阅读约需6分钟。
📝

内容提要

本文探讨了AI时代独立开发者选择TailwindCSS组件库的情况,推荐了shadcn/ui、Flowbite、Rewind-UI等库,分析了它们的特点和适用场景,以帮助开发者快速做出选择。未来组件库可能发展为“大而全”或“小而精”。

🎯

关键要点

  • 文章探讨了AI时代独立开发者选择TailwindCSS组件库的情况。

  • 推荐了shadcn/ui、Flowbite、Rewind-UI等组件库,并分析它们的特点和适用场景。

  • shadcn/ui提供基础组件,适合快速拼装设计体系,但功能有限。

  • 开发者在选择组件库时面临选择困难,需考虑轻量性和设计感。

  • 横评维度包括开发体验、组件覆盖、可访问性、主题与风格、适合场景。

  • Flowbite React提供丰富的UI组件,适合需要现成模块的项目。

  • Rewind-UI轻量且可定制,适合追求干净体验的开发者。

  • daisyUI通过CSS类提供主题和组件,适合不想依赖JS的开发者。

  • TailGrids React提供600多个组件,适合需要大量UI组合的项目。

  • Origin UI提供500多个组件,是shadcn/ui的补充,值得关注。

  • HeroUI风格独特,但与Next.js不兼容,使用时需谨慎。

  • 未来组件库可能发展为大而全或小而精,AI辅助UI生成将模糊Figma与代码的边界。

  • 希望文章能帮助开发者减少选择焦虑,欢迎交流使用经验。

延伸问答

在选择TailwindCSS组件库时,开发者应该考虑哪些因素?

开发者在选择TailwindCSS组件库时,应考虑开发体验、组件覆盖、可访问性、主题与风格以及适合场景等因素。

shadcn/ui组件库的特点是什么?

shadcn/ui提供基础组件,适合快速拼装设计体系,但功能有限,主要用于低层级UI组件。

Flowbite React适合什么样的项目?

Flowbite React提供丰富的UI组件,适合需要大量现成模块且希望快速上手的项目。

Rewind-UI与其他组件库相比有什么优势?

Rewind-UI轻量且可定制,适合追求干净体验的开发者,且遵循可访问性标准。

daisyUI适合哪些开发者使用?

daisyUI通过CSS类提供主题和组件,适合不想依赖JavaScript的开发者,喜欢轻松切换主题。

未来TailwindCSS组件库的发展趋势是什么?

未来TailwindCSS组件库可能发展为大而全或小而精,AI辅助UI生成将模糊Figma与代码的边界。

➡️

继续阅读